Based: Onsite at Rolls-Royce - Derby (static)

Hours: 40 - Monday to Friday

Role Summary: We are looking for a qualified and reliable Air Conditioning Engineer to carry out service maintenance works on our Rolls-Royce contract in Derby. The successful candidate will provide a professional service to our client working on a varied selection of Air Conditioning systems. If you are looking for a varied static sites role, then this is a unique opportunity in Derby.

Main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Attend and complete PPMs & Reactive works as scheduled including breakdowns
  • Have install experience (retrofit/system replacements)
  • Troubleshooting/ Fault finding on all A/C systems
  • To produce quotations for works/remedials following service visits
  • To work on Splits, VRFs, AHUs and DX systems and some Central Plant
  • To be able to work alone and with other team members when necessary
  • Complete all FGAS paperwork on sites and update logbooks in client premises
  • To be part of the Out of Hours Call Out Rota

Qualifications and Experience:

  • C&G 2079 Cat1 NVQ Level 3 or similar
  • F-Gas
  • Good Mechanical & Electrical Background
  • Must have experience in a similar role
  • Knowledge of building fabric and experience in carrying out basic fabric reactive repairs
  • Sound understanding of Health & Safety obligations with regards to maintenance activities
  • Must be prepared to work out of hours when required and on a scheduled callout rota
  • Have good communication and organisation skills
  • UK Driving License
  • Good understanding of IT packages including Outlook, Word etc

If successful, you will be required to pass SC clearance.
